Many times these codes are set not necessarily due to a bad or malfunctioning part but due to either low voltage (like a bad battery) or a bad ground to one of the components in the AH/TCS system.

I had the code set once for the steering wheel position sensor but just unplugged and replugged the 4 pin connector on the sensor about 4 times and it never came back again.
I had checked with Watson Chev in Tucson when I got the code and they quoted me a total cost for both parts and labor of just under $350 if it needed to be replaced.
